Feminine declension scheme:
This is the Feminine declension of the word Pānīyaśālā following the rules for -ā.
feminine ā-stem declension for 'Pānīyaśālā'
single | dual | plural | |
---|---|---|---|
nominative. | pānīyaśālā | pānīyaśāle | pānīyaśālāḥ |
accusative. | pānīyaśālām | pānīyaśāle | pānīyaśālāḥ |
instrumental. | pānīyaśālayā | pānīyaśālābhyām | pānīyaśālābhiḥ |
dative. | pānīyaśālāyai | pānīyaśālābhyām | pānīyaśālābhyaḥ |
ablative. | pānīyaśālāyāḥ | pānīyaśālābhyām | pānīyaśālābhyaḥ |
genitive. | pānīyaśālāyāḥ | pānīyaśālayoḥ | pānīyaśālānām |
locative. | pānīyaśālāyām | pānīyaśālayoḥ | pānīyaśālāsu |
vocative. | pānīyaśāle | pānīyaśāle | pānīyaśālāḥ |
